Section 19

Guardian Not to Be Appointed by the Court in Certain Cases.

The Guardians and Wards Act, 1890
Nothing in this Chapter shall authorise the Court to appoint or declare a guardian of the property of a minor whose property is under the superintendence of a Court of Wards, or to appoint or declare a guardian of the person—

(a) of a minor who is a married female and whose husband is not, in the opinion of the Court, unfit to be guardian of her person, or


1 [(b) of a minor, other than a married female, whose father or mother is living and is not, in the opinion of the court, unfit to be guardian of the person of the minor, or.]


(c) of a minor whose property is under the superintendence of a Court of Wards competent to appoint a guardian of the person of the minor.




1. Subs. by Act 30 of 2010, s. 2 for sub-clause (b) (w.e.f. 31-8-2010).
